Kinston City Council approved the purchase of eight police vehicles, authorized a federal grant application for two additional officers assigned to housing communities and set a public hearing on renaming Springhill Street as Maceo Parker Way during its Tuesday, Aug. 4, regular meeting.

Eastern North Carolina author Venita Wright-Blake, who writes under the pen name Wright Blake, has been named the winner of the 2026 American Fiction Award in the Religious Thriller category for her debut novel, Unbroken Grace.

Lenoir County officials broke ground Wednesday morning on a new sheriff’s annex intended to improve law enforcement response times and expand access to public safety services in southern Lenoir County.

JONES COUNTY - Jones County officials said the county’s water system meets state and federal drinking water standards following public comments and social media discussion about staining and water sampling.
